One-Pot Chili Mac

Featured in: Weeknight Dinners

This one-pot chili mac combines tender ground beef with diced onions, bell peppers, and garlic, all simmered alongside kidney beans and elbow macaroni in a spiced tomato broth. The dish is finished with creamy shredded cheddar cheese for a rich, comforting meal. Perfect for quick preparation and easy cleanup, it offers hearty warmth with just 35 minutes total cooking time. Optional sour cream topping adds a cool, tangy contrast.

For variety, swap ground beef with turkey or plant-based crumbles, and add heat with cayenne pepper or jalapeño. Fresh garnishes like green onions or cilantro brighten the flavors. This dish caters to family-friendly tastes while providing hearty protein and satisfying textures in every bite.

Updated on Wed, 24 Dec 2025 14:17:00 GMT
Steaming bowl of one-pot chili mac with melted cheddar and a dollop of sour cream. Save to Pinterest
Steaming bowl of one-pot chili mac with melted cheddar and a dollop of sour cream. | shiftpan.com

There's something magical about a one-pot meal that somehow tastes like you've been cooking all day, when really you've only spent 35 minutes at the stove. I discovered this chili mac on a particularly chaotic Tuesday when my roommate texted asking if I could feed four people on short notice, and I realized I had exactly the right ingredients sitting in my pantry. That first batch came together almost by accident, and watching everyone go back for seconds despite not knowing what they were eating felt like winning the kitchen lottery.

My favorite memory with this dish happened on a snowy evening when I made it for my book club, expecting it to be the side dish nobody touched. Instead, two people asked for the recipe before dessert even came out, and we spent the next hour debating whether the smoked paprika or the sour cream swirl was the real MVP. That's when I realized this wasn't just an easy weeknight dinner—it was the kind of food that makes people feel taken care of.

Ingredients

  • Ground beef (1 lb): This is your umami backbone, so don't shy away from a slightly fattier cut—it'll render into the sauce and keep everything creamy and rich as it simmers.
  • Onion and bell pepper (1 medium onion, 1 red pepper): These soften into almost nothing, but they're doing the heavy lifting in flavor, so take the 30 seconds to dice them evenly.
  • Garlic (3 cloves, minced): Mince it small enough that it practically melts into the spice base—this prevents harsh raw bites.
  • Kidney beans (1 can, drained): Rinsing them under cold water removes the tin-canned taste and keeps your final dish tasting fresh.
  • Diced tomatoes and tomato sauce (1 can each, 15 oz): The combo of chunky tomatoes and smooth sauce gives you texture and body without needing to blend anything.
  • Beef or vegetable broth (2 cups): Use the good stuff if you have it—this is going to be your final sauce, so weak broth makes a weak finish.
  • Elbow macaroni (2 cups uncooked): Don't cook it separately; it drinks up all those flavors as it cooks right in the pot.
  • Chili powder, cumin, smoked paprika, oregano, salt, and pepper: Toast these spices by cooking them briefly in fat after the vegetables soften—it's the moment your kitchen starts smelling like you know what you're doing.
  • Cheddar cheese (1½ cups shredded): Sharp cheddar holds its flavor better than mild, and the shreds melt faster than chunks.
  • Sour cream (½ cup, optional): A dollop on top adds tang that cuts through the richness and makes every bite taste brighter.

Instructions

Product image
Make fresh ice for iced coffee, cocktails, chilling ingredients, and keeping drinks cold while cooking.
Check price on Amazon
Brown the beef:
Heat your pot over medium-high heat and let it get hot before the meat touches down—you'll hear a satisfying sizzle that means the surface is caramelizing instead of steaming. Break it apart with your spoon as it cooks, making sure no clump stays bigger than a pea.
Build the flavor base:
Once the beef is browned, add your diced onion, bell pepper, and garlic to the same pot without draining (well, unless there's a real pool of grease). That fat carries flavor, so work with it for the next 3–4 minutes until the vegetables soften and lose their raw edges.
Bloom the spices:
This is the non-negotiable step: stir in your chili powder, cumin, paprika, oregano, salt, and pepper, and let them cook for exactly one minute. You'll smell the shift from raw spice powder to something warm and complex—that's the moment you know it's working.
Add everything else:
Pour in your beans (rinsed, remember), the chunky tomatoes, the smooth tomato sauce, broth, and uncooked pasta. Stir everything together so nothing's stuck to the bottom and the pasta is submerged as much as possible.
Simmer until tender:
Bring it to a boil first—you'll see it bubble at the edges—then turn the heat down to medium-low and cover it. Let it cook for 12–15 minutes, stirring every few minutes so the pasta cooks evenly and doesn't clump.
Finish with cheese:
When the pasta is tender (taste a piece if you're unsure), uncover the pot and stir in your shredded cheese off the heat. The residual warmth melts it into this creamy sauce without making it grainy.
Serve with intention:
Ladle it into bowls and top with a spoonful of sour cream if you have it—the coldness of the cream against the heat of the chili is its own small comfort.
Product image
Make fresh ice for iced coffee, cocktails, chilling ingredients, and keeping drinks cold while cooking.
Check price on Amazon
Save to Pinterest
| shiftpan.com

I made this for my neighbor who'd just started a new job and didn't have time to cook, and she cried a little when I handed her the container—not because it was fancy, but because someone had made her actual food. That moment crystallized something for me: the best recipes aren't the ones with ten specialty ingredients or Instagram-worthy plating. They're the ones that show up when you need them.

The One-Pot Magic Behind This Dish

There's real science happening when you cook pasta directly in the sauce instead of in a separate pot of water. The starch from the pasta dissolves into the broth, turning everything thicker and creamier without a drop of cream—it's basically the pasta doing half the work for you. This also means the flavors have nowhere to escape; everything stays in the pot where it belongs.

Why This Works as Comfort Food

Chili and mac and cheese are two of the most primal comfort foods on their own, so combining them feels like someone understood exactly what you needed before you even asked. The chili brings earthiness and heat, while the macaroni softens everything and makes it feel safe. It's the culinary equivalent of a warm hug from someone who's known you for years.

The Shortcuts and Swaps That Actually Work

This recipe is flexible in ways that matter and strict in ways that don't. You can swap the beef for turkey, use canned black beans instead of kidney beans, or even go vegetarian if you use a hearty vegetable broth and add an extra can of diced tomatoes for body. The one thing you really shouldn't skip is the smoked paprika—it's what makes this taste like someone who cares made it.

  • If you want more heat, add a minced jalapeño with the vegetables or sprinkle cayenne pepper on top instead of mixing it in.
  • Leftover chili mac thickens as it sits in the fridge, so add a splash of broth or water when you reheat it.
  • This doubles easily for a crowd, but remember to add an extra 5 minutes to the simmering time if you're cooking a bigger batch.
Product image
Whisk eggs, batters, sauces, and cream smoothly for baking, cooking, and everyday meal prep.
Check price on Amazon
Hearty one-pot chili mac: a close-up shows tender macaroni with flavorful ground beef and savory spices. Save to Pinterest
Hearty one-pot chili mac: a close-up shows tender macaroni with flavorful ground beef and savory spices. | shiftpan.com

This is the kind of recipe that stays in your rotation forever once you make it, not because it's complicated or requires special skill, but because it works every single time and makes people happy. Make it on a Tuesday, make it for a crowd, make it when you're tired and hungry—it'll show up for you.

Questions & Answers About This Recipe

Can I use ground turkey instead of beef?

Yes, ground turkey works well as a lighter alternative, maintaining the dish's texture while reducing fat content.

How can I make this dish spicier?

Add ½ tsp cayenne pepper or include a diced jalapeño with the vegetables when sautéing for extra heat.

What type of pasta is best to use?

Elbow macaroni is ideal as it holds sauce well and softens nicely during simmering but other small pasta shapes can also be used.

Is it possible to prepare this in advance?

This dish can be made ahead and reheated; just add a splash of broth or water when warming to maintain creamy consistency.

Can I omit the cheese or sour cream?

Yes, although cheese adds creaminess and flavor, the dish remains flavorful without dairy toppings or can be served with a dairy-free alternative.

One-Pot Chili Mac

A savory one-pot dish blending chili spices, ground meat, macaroni, and cheddar cheese in a creamy mix.

Prep Time
10 min
Time to Cook
25 min
Total Duration
35 min
Recipe by Emma Miller


Skill Level Easy

Cuisine American

Serves 6 Portions

Dietary Info None specified

What You'll Need

Meats

01 1 lb ground beef (or turkey for lighter option)

Vegetables

01 1 medium onion, diced
02 1 red bell pepper, diced
03 3 cloves garlic, minced

Pantry

01 1 can (15 oz) kidney beans, drained and rinsed
02 1 can (15 oz) diced tomatoes
03 1 can (15 oz) tomato sauce
04 2 cups beef or vegetable broth
05 2 cups uncooked elbow macaroni

Spices

01 2 tbsp chili powder
02 1 tsp ground cumin
03 1 tsp smoked paprika
04 ½ tsp dried oregano
05 ½ tsp salt
06 ¼ tsp black pepper

Dairy

01 1½ cups shredded cheddar cheese
02 ½ cup sour cream (optional, for serving)

How to Make It

Step 01

Brown the meat: In a large pot or Dutch oven, brown the ground beef over medium-high heat, breaking it apart as it cooks. Drain excess fat if necessary.

Step 02

Sauté vegetables: Add diced onion, bell pepper, and minced garlic to the pot. Cook for 3 to 4 minutes until softened.

Step 03

Add spices: Stir in chili powder, cumin, smoked paprika, oregano, salt, and black pepper. Cook for 1 minute until fragrant.

Step 04

Combine remaining ingredients: Add kidney beans, diced tomatoes, tomato sauce, broth, and uncooked macaroni. Stir thoroughly to combine.

Step 05

Simmer: Bring mixture to a boil, then reduce heat to medium-low. Cover and simmer for 12 to 15 minutes, stirring occasionally, until pasta is tender.

Step 06

Incorporate cheese: Remove lid and stir in shredded cheddar cheese until melted and creamy.

Step 07

Serve: Serve hot, optionally topped with a dollop of sour cream.

What You'll Need

  • Large pot or Dutch oven
  • Wooden spoon or spatula
  • Knife and cutting board
  • Can opener

Allergy Details

Review all items for allergies and speak to a healthcare expert with any concerns.
  • Contains dairy and wheat
  • May contain soy or gluten depending on broth and canned products
  • Use certified gluten-free pasta for gluten-free preparation

Nutrition Details (per serving)

For reference only — always check with a nutrition or medical professional.
  • Caloric Value: 485
  • Fats: 18 g
  • Carbohydrates: 52 g
  • Proteins: 29 g